The Home Energy Saver program offers eligible households an interest-free loan of up to $15,000 and for lower-income households, a discount of up to $4,000 towards solar panels, solar batteries and other efficient upgrades. On top of that, home batteries attract an upfront federal discount through the Cheaper Home Batteries Program, plus a separate NSW incentive for connecting your battery to a Virtual Power Plant. The NSW Home Energy Saver Program provides a range of incentives to the eligible household to make energy efficiency improvements more affordable. If applicable, you may have the option to get an interest-free loan or incentives from the government and batteries to make the investment in approved renewable energy solutions more economical.
Eligibility depends on the type of support you're applying for. Interest-free loans and discounts have different requirements based on factors such as your household income, the upgrade you're choosing and your property. We'll help you understand which options are available to you.
Eligible households may be able to access support for solar panels, solar batteries, hot water heat pumps and other approved energy-efficient upgrades. We'll recommend the solutions that best suit your home and explain the incentives available for each.
In many cases, yes. Eligible households may be able to combine the NSW Home Energy Saver Program with Federal battery incentives and other available government support. We'll identify every incentive you're eligible for and show how they work together.
Yes. Eligible NSW households may be able to access an interest-free loan of up to $15,000 to help spread the cost of approved energy upgrades. We'll explain the eligibility requirements and guide you through the application process.
The amount you save depends on your eligibility, the products you choose and the incentives available when you apply. We'll provide a personalised quote that clearly outlines your estimated discounts, loans and any available battery incentives.
Eligible battery installations may qualify for an upfront discount through the Australian Government's Cheaper Home Batteries Program, along with a NSW incentive for connecting your battery to a Virtual Power Plant (VPP). We'll help you understand which incentives apply to your installation.
